Quest Resource Holding Corporation (QRHC)
NASDAQ: QRHC · Real-Time Price · USD
2.350
-0.120 (-4.86%)
May 13, 2025, 4:00 PM - Market closed

Quest Resource Holding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
May '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
4813414712113242
Upgrade
Market Cap Growth
-69.04%-8.99%21.82%-8.56%210.89%26.89%
Upgrade
Enterprise Value
12420720618714041
Upgrade
Last Close Price
2.356.507.336.116.942.31
Upgrade
PE Ratio
----78.0651.20
Upgrade
Forward PE
----56.6528.88
Upgrade
PS Ratio
0.170.460.510.430.850.43
Upgrade
PB Ratio
1.092.472.221.701.790.62
Upgrade
P/FCF Ratio
----65.3216.00
Upgrade
P/OCF Ratio
----51.4513.71
Upgrade
EV/Sales Ratio
0.440.720.710.660.900.42
Upgrade
EV/EBITDA Ratio
18.2618.1114.3112.9715.3714.07
Upgrade
EV/EBIT Ratio
-178.1146.3041.8322.0724.82
Upgrade
EV/FCF Ratio
----69.3515.63
Upgrade
Debt / Equity Ratio
1.731.461.021.040.890.25
Upgrade
Debt / EBITDA Ratio
10.126.474.464.806.754.78
Upgrade
Debt / FCF Ratio
----32.536.32
Upgrade
Asset Turnover
1.651.641.611.591.121.08
Upgrade
Quick Ratio
1.411.411.301.461.281.44
Upgrade
Current Ratio
1.461.691.351.521.331.51
Upgrade
Return on Equity (ROE)
-44.84%-25.01%-10.61%-8.36%2.39%1.59%
Upgrade
Return on Assets (ROA)
-0.99%0.41%1.55%1.57%2.86%1.14%
Upgrade
Return on Capital (ROIC)
-1.32%0.54%1.99%1.97%3.54%1.37%
Upgrade
Return on Capital Employed (ROCE)
-0.90%3.40%3.10%4.60%2.00%
Upgrade
Earnings Yield
-51.17%-11.26%-4.96%-5.01%1.28%2.44%
Upgrade
FCF Yield
-17.36%-8.05%-1.10%-2.63%1.53%6.25%
Upgrade
Buyback Yield / Dilution
-2.48%-2.46%-3.33%6.08%-23.75%-9.18%
Upgrade
Updated May 12,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q